CVE-2025-27737: Windows Security Zone Mapping Security Feature Bypass Vulnerability

First published: Tue Apr 08 2025(Updated: )

<p>Improper input validation in Windows Security Zone Mapping allows an unauthorized attacker to bypass a security feature locally.</p>
